NFS lockd problems:

I am having difficulties with lockd running away and bringing a system
down to its knees, requiring one to kill it to get sanity back.

A centralized mail system (using a centralized /var/spool/mail via NFS)
was installed on another host.  The mail server uses a local mount to
process mail, but all the other hosts (including the one with the runaway
lockd) access the spool via nfs.

The latest sendmail from uunet is the one in use on the server, and the
bind 4.9 in.named is used to handle DNS.

Is there anyone out there who knows what causes lockd to run away,
and what changes one needs to make (either in mail user agents or sendmail)
to get around this annoyance?  This has shown up intermittently since
the centralized server was set up.

For the moment, lockd was killed.  Impact of leaving it dead are not
known yet, there is no commercial software (site is a public access
internet host with dialup shell access).
